Fashion Takes Center Stage as Royal Ascot 2026 Unites Glamour, Tradition, and Celebrity Culture in a Dazzling Display




Royal Ascot 2026 has once again dazzled spectators with its vibrant fashion, marking the prestigious horse racing event as a key date on the celebrity calendar. With the sun shining brightly, attendees dressed to impress, embracing the occasion and making bold sartorial statements. Although the Royal Enclosure maintains a traditional dress code requiring dresses to be knee-length or longer, with specific guidelines on shoulder straps and headwear, this year’s event saw guests push the boundaries of elegance and creativity. As umbrellas were absent and rain did not threaten the fun, exuberance reigned supreme, and millinery—extravagant hats and headpieces—became a highlight of the week. It can be said that attendees turned the racetrack into a fashion runway, showcasing their finest ensembles.



Among the standout appearances was Catherine, Princess of Wales, who made a stylish return to the racecourse for the first time since 2023. Arriving with Prince William, Catherine turned heads in a striking yellow Roksanda dress, first worn in 2022 and a beloved choice for summer outings. This dress, paired with a matching Jane Taylor headpiece, perfectly adhered to the event’s dress code while also placing her at the forefront of the Best Dressed list for the week. Catherine’s knack for balancing tradition with contemporary fashion makes her a perennial favorite in the fashion stakes, ensuring her presence is always a highlight of Ascot.


Model Erin O'Connor also made a noteworthy impression, showcasing the official color of the 2026 races—vivid tomato red. O'Connor wore an elegant gown by Erdem, complete with a luxurious feathered headdress that added flair to her already stunning outfit. Her presence was complemented by the radiant sunshine, which allowed her to truly shine on this prestigious day. Additionally, actress Saffron Hocking turned up the heat in a dazzling aquamarine maxi dress that flowed gracefully with her movements, embodying the summer spirit and the festive atmosphere of the occasion.



The fashion at Royal Ascot is not just limited to traditional styles; it also allows for playful interpretation. Newlyweds Peter Phillips and his wife were another couple to grace the racetrack, with Peter dressed in a chic white lace ensemble by Beulah London. The festivities also saw beloved pop star and fashion icon from the Sugababes, who opted for an off-white dress paired with a sophisticated black hat—exemplifying a modern twist on a classic look. Meanwhile, the Royal Ascot creative director showcased his own tailored style. He donned a classic Favourbrook morning suit complemented by a stylish Dior tie and a Lock & Co top hat, demonstrating that men’s fashion at the races is just as vital and eye-catching.


Staying true to the royal spirit, Zara Tindall, a member of the British royal family, radiated joy in a butter-yellow ensemble synonymous with the Royal Enclosure’s dress code. Her outfit combined elegance and playfulness, standing out in the crowd as she embraced the fashion opportunities the event provides. Other stylish attendees included an actress in a shimmering sequin dress by Mithridate, accompanied by a bold cerise pink hat that showcased her fashion-forward thinking.
